The length of time it takes to groom a dog at Shaggy's Pet Shoppe is normally distributed a mean of 45 minutes and a standard deviation of 10 minutes. What is the probability that a dog takes more than 60 minutes to groom? What is the probability that a dog takes less than 30 minutes to groom? What is the probability that a dog takes between 20 minutes and 60 minutes to groom?
